Handover for Priya — the Wexmoor quarry site still has no working printer, so payroll printed this month's payslips here and sealed them individually. They're banded by crew in a locked satchel at the dispatch desk. Please schedule the run for Friday morning before shift change so the site clerk can distribute them same day. The confidential hand-over instruction follows below.

handover note for yagef-bagep: the drudor pelius courier leaves the kasdor zorvan norir ledger at gate 8016 under passcode 755406

Step 4 — Enabling the orphaned-resource sweeper (Project Tidewrack)

Before approving this step, confirm the sweeper's dry-run output was attached to the change record and that no volume older than 30 days appears outside the exclusion list. The sweeper deletes irreversibly, so the reviewer must check that the grace window is set to 72 hours, not the default 24. Once satisfied, enable sweep mode on one region only and observe for a full cycle. The sweeper binary is signed, and deploys must present the key that follows.

release key, fahaf-bajof: bky3_Xam

## Tuning DocSweep

DocSweep's defaults are deliberately conservative, so before a release you'll probably want to loosen a few knobs — especially line-length and heading-depth checks, which trip constantly on changelog files. All tunables live in one config block and hot-apply on save, so no rebuild needed. The defaults we ship for the Larkfield docs repo are:

tuning table, yajog-yahof:
BUDGETS = {
    "lamvan": 303,
    "wenox": 460,
    "fenvan": 525,
}

# Break-Glass: Catalog Cache Invalidation

Scope: the Pinrow product catalog at Veldstone Retail. If stale prices persist after a purge and the Hollowmere invalidation queue is wedged, use break-glass to flush the edge tier directly. Contractors: get verbal sign-off from the catalog lead first. Steps: open the Hollowmere admin shell, select emergency-flush, confirm the tenant, and run it once — repeated flushes thrash the origin. Access is logged and expires after 20 minutes. Unseal the admin shell with the passphrase below.

recovery phrase for kahop-tajog: istix-casvan